    Quote Originally Posted by jigman51 View Post
    I bought a Suzuki 150 in the late 90s and it was bullet proof, not one issue. It came with a 6 year warranty, even back then.
    I bought what was probably the same motor around 2000 on a deckboat. I put more hours than I can count on it in 15 years, virtually all of them with a tube or a skier behind it. I think around year six or so I changed the plugs just because I felt bad that I hadn’t done anything to it. I changed the impeller and fluids occasionally but never winterized it or ran additives. It never sputtered. Not once. Best engine I’ve ever owned on any type of vehicle. Sold it to another family and they’ve run it with the same results.

    I’d buy another one in a heartbeat.
